Born April 17, 1938, in Porterville, California to Robert and Virginia Marshall.
Passed away July 11, 2025, in Afton, Wyoming after a short illness.
Virginia had an adventurous childhood, traveling across the country with her family for her father's work before settling in Arco, Idaho as a teenager. There, she met the love of her life, Lyal Radford. After a whirlwind two-week romance, they eloped to Elko, Nevada when she was just 16. It was the beginning of a lifetime love story. Their life together was full of travel due to Lyal's work in construction. Virginia gave birth to their first child Angela in 1956 and welcomed Lyal Jr. (Fred) in 1962. In 1972, they adopted Kenny, completing their family. The Radfords moved to Jackson, Wyoming in 1964, where they lived for 27 years. Virginia worked at several local businesses, including the Ranch Shops, Toppers Steakhouse, the Antler Motel, and finally the trust department at Jackson State Bank. She was known for her dedication, work ethic, and loyalty.
In 1991, they moved to Star Valley Ranch. Retirement didn't slow Virginia down. She and her close friend Liz Beck became deeply involved in community volunteer work. Virginia played a key role in the American Cancer Society, Star Valley Health's Hospital Auxiliary, the Gifts of Joy gift shop, and was instrumental in fundraising for the new hospital. She later served on the hospital's Board of Directors, continuing her service well into her 70s.
After Lyal's passing in 2012, Virginia remained active. She enjoyed attending her great-grandchildren's games, playing cards with friends, and spending winters in Florida and Nevada with her daughter Angela. She embraced every season of life fully and with grace. Virginia was a devoted daughter, wife, mother, grandmother, great-grandmother, sister, and friend. In her final months, she faced congestive heart failure and peacefully chose to reunite with her beloved Lyal on July 11th.
She was preceded in death by her husband, parents, in-laws, son-in-law, three brothers, and many other cherished family members. She is survived by her children: Angela and companion Ken, Lyal Jr. (Fred) and wife Brandi, Kenny, and bonus daughter Sheila Keating and husband Richard, 12 grandchildren, 19 great-grandchildren, and many loving friends and extended family.
